Output d89d7faef9ff5518add95345231b2e446d79fe73c43397cfd124e50195bc2ff0:0

value
13091528
script pubkey
OP_0 OP_PUSHBYTES_20 a6a3cc346f199c88b6f4be3396b91bfed8e8e158
address
bc1q563ucdr0rxwg3dh5hceedwgmlmvw3c2cy2fw6r
transaction
d89d7faef9ff5518add95345231b2e446d79fe73c43397cfd124e50195bc2ff0
confirmations
45597
spent
true